In the middle of the Jewish holiday of Hanukkah, signs of hate were discovered posted all around one Vermont community. Several signs targeting Jewish people reading "It’s okay to be anti-Semitic" were spotted in downtown Saint Albans. City employees quickly responded by immediately taking them down. Police say they're investigating. According to the Anti-Defamation League, anti-Semitic crimes have risen sharply since 2016.
